Ben Hager
CA EDM MS-438-EA-207-202 · Unidad documental simple · 1-Oct-68
Parte de Phil Cox fonds

Benjamin Hager was a teacher and later was the chairman of the Edmonton Federation of Community Leagues. Known as Mr. Talent Show, he died in 1972.

Grace Martin McEachern
CA EDM MS-438-EA-207-204 · Unidad documental simple · 1-May-80
Parte de Phil Cox fonds

Grace Martin was a teacher in Edmonton at the turn of the century. She continued teaching after her marriage, and after retirement continued to be involved with education. She celebrated her 108th birthday with students at the Grace Martin Elementary School in 1989.
